Firm: Anna Catherine Pelligra Law LLC

Anna C. Pelligra established ACP Law after years of dedicated focus in the field of wills, trusts, and estates. With deep roots in Manasquan, New Jersey, where she grew up on the Glimmer Glass, Anna has a profound appreciation for the salt air and year-round beach culture that defines her hometown.. Before beginning her legal career, Anna dedicated a decade to serving as an Ocean Rescue Lifeguard with the Manasquan Beach Patrol on the Whiting Avenue and Inlet beaches. This experience not only deepened her sense of community but also sharpened her skills in quick decision-making, responsibility, and proactive planning for the challenges posed by the ocean’s unpredictable conditions.. Anna earned her Bachelor of Science degree in Business Administration from Widener University, followed by a Juris Doctor from Villanova University Charles Widger School of Law. She began her legal career at boutique trust and estate firms in Monmouth and Morris Counties, specializing in drafting wills, living wills, healthcare directives, powers of attorney, revocable trusts, irrevocable life insurance trusts (ILITs), spousal lifetime access trusts (SLATs), and various other estate planning documents.. Recognizing that planning for the future can be both complex and emotional, Anna approaches each situation with compassion, sensitivity, and a deep understanding of the law. Her commitment is to guide clients through the intricacies of estate planning with personalized attention and care.
